Creative Garden Solutions with Upcycled Planters

Upcycled Planters

Are you looking to add a touch of creativity and sustainability to your garden? Upcycled planters are a fantastic way to repurpose items that would otherwise end up in the landfill while giving your outdoor space a unique and stylish look. Let's explore some creative garden solutions using upcycled planters!

1. Tin Cans

Old tin cans can be transformed into charming planters with a bit of paint and creativity. Clean the cans thoroughly, paint them in your preferred color, and drill drainage holes at the bottom. You can hang them on a fence or arrange them on a shelf for a quirky garden display.

2. Wooden Crates

Wooden crates have a rustic charm that makes them perfect for upcycled planters. Line the crates with landscape fabric to prevent soil from spilling out, fill them with your favorite plants, and place them on your patio or deck. You can even stack multiple crates to create a vertical garden.

3. Old Tires

Give old tires a new lease on life by turning them into planters for flowers or herbs. Paint the tires in bright colors to add a pop of personality to your garden. Stack them up to create a unique tiered planter or lay them flat and fill them with soil for a more traditional look.

4. Bathtubs

Repurpose an old bathtub as a large planter for shrubs or small trees. Place the bathtub in a sunny spot in your garden, drill drainage holes in the bottom, and fill it with nutrient-rich soil. The bathtub planter will make a striking focal point in your outdoor space.

5. Tea Kettles or Teapots

Tea kettles or teapots can add a whimsical touch to your garden when used as planters for succulents or small flowers. Simply fill them with well-draining soil and plant your favorite greenery. These upcycled planters work well on windowsills, tables, or as part of a garden vignette.

Get creative with your garden design by incorporating upcycled planters into your outdoor space. Not only will you be reducing waste and helping the environment, but you'll also have a garden that stands out with its unique and eco-friendly style!
